Overview of the Activity

Ice climbing at Sólheimajökull in Vik, Iceland is an exciting activity offered by Hyperborea Tours.

This tour provides all necessary equipment, including climbing belts, ice axes, harnesses, and crampons. The maximum group size is 4 travelers, ensuring personalized attention from the knowledgeable guides.

With a rating of 5.0 based on 8 reviews, the activity is highly recommended. However, it’s not suitable for those with back problems, pregnant travelers, or those with heart conditions, as a moderate level of physical fitness is required.

The tour starts and ends at the Sólheimajökull parking lot.

Meeting Point and Transportation

ice-climbing-at-solheimajokull-2

Participants are required to meet at the designated meeting point, the parking lot in front of the only house at Sólheimajökull, 871, Iceland.

From the meeting point, the guides will lead the group to the ice climbing site. At the end of the experience, the group will return to the original meeting location.

The activity isn’t wheelchair accessible, and travelers with back problems, pregnant women, or those with heart conditions or serious medical issues aren’t recommended to participate.

Transportation to and from the meeting point isn’t included in the activity price.

Duration and Pricing

The ice climbing experience at Sólheimajökull is priced from $325.00 per person.

This price includes the necessary equipment, such as a climbing belt, ice axes, harness, crampons, clothing, and boots.

The maximum group size is 4 travelers, allowing for a more personalized experience.

Free cancellation is available up to 24 hours before the start of the activity.

The duration of the experience isn’t explicitly stated, but it takes place at the Sólheimajökull glacier, with the meeting and end point being the parking lot in front of the only house in the area.
